Summary The Dishwasher is responsible for the maintenance of dishes, pots, pans, trays, kitchen, work areas, equipment and utensils in a clean, orderly and sanitary condition in accordance with current applicable federal, state and local standards, guidelines and regulations. The focus of the Dishwasher includes general dishwasher and cleaning responsibilities to ensure the complete cleanliness and sanitation of the kitchen and work areas. Essential Job Responsibilities Scrapes/rinses food from dirty dishes and washes them by hand or places them in racks or on conveyor to dishwashing machine depending on assigned equipment. Ensure complete cleanliness and sanitation. Washes pots, pans, and trays based on assigned procedures. Ensure complete cleanliness and sanitation. Let dry completely before storing or reusing. Polishes silver using burnishing machine tumbler, chemical dip, buffing wheel, and hand cloth depending on assigned equipment and procedures. Ensure complete cleanliness and sanitation. Ensure compliance with all outlined safety procedures, up to and including use of cut gloves when handling and cleaning knives. Maintain and track temperatures and chemical levels as outlined by provided standards. Let supervisor know in a timely manner if levels are off. Clean and maintain dish area in an orderly manner to include mats, clear walkway and in compliance with all other safety standards. Sweeps and mops kitchen floors at appropriate intervals to ensure compliance with safety and sanitation standards. Washes worktables, walls, refrigerators, and meat blocks and all other food prep surface as assigned. Segregates and removes trash and garbage and places it in designated containers. Steam cleans or hoses out garbage cans in appropriate and assigned areas. Transfers supplies and equipment between storage and work areas observing all safe lifting standards. May assist with loading or unloading supplies and product. Perform other functions and duties as assigned. How much does a prep cook/dishwasher earn in Grand Rapids, MI?

The average prep cook/dishwasher in Grand Rapids, MI earns between $21,000 and $35,000 annually. This compares to the national average prep cook/dishwasher range of $25,000 to $39,000.
